In Army JROTC, what does LET stand for?

Explanation:
Leadership Education and Training. This phrase shows how Army JROTC builds cadet leaders through both instruction (education) and practical, hands-on leadership activities (training). The official term does not include a comma or alternate words like Teaching or Encouragement, so the standard wording is Leadership Education and Training. In practice, JROTC uses LET levels to structure cadet development from initial leadership basics to more advanced responsibilities, all within that same framework of learning and applying leadership skills.
